What is the story of the Spanish Armada?







Catholic Spain wanted to invade Protestant England and overthrow Elizabeth I Spanish Armada was defeated by English Spain starts to lose power

What is the story/ outcome of the John Peter Zenger trial?







Zenger criticized NY’s governor (against the law) Zenger was set free because it was all true Establishes Freedom of the Press

New England 





Geography: Rocky soil, long winters Economics: Fishing, Shipbuilding, trading, small farms Society: Mostly English settlers, some Africans

Middle Colonies 





Geography: Good soil, shorter winters Economy: Merchants and large farms (bread basket) Society: Lots of different cultures

Southern Colonies 

Geography: Fertile soil, long growing season



Economy: Plantations



Society: English settlers, African slaves

Backcountry 

Geography: In/ Around Appalachian Mts.



Economy: Small Farms/ Fur Trade



Society: Scots-Irish Clans
